Testosterone injections help restore normal testosterone levels, which can support the development of male characteristics, enhance muscle mass, improve bone density, increase libido, and boost overall energy and mood.
Testosterone injections are a form of hormone replacement therapy (HRT) used to treat low testosterone levels in men, a condition known as hypogonadism. Testosterone is the primary male sex hormone that plays a key role in maintaining various body functions, such as muscle mass, bone density, libido, and energy levels. When a man’s testosterone levels drop below normal, it can lead to symptoms such as fatigue, low sex drive, loss of muscle mass, and mood changes.
Testosterone injections work by delivering synthetic testosterone into the bloodstream, helping to restore normal levels of the hormone. These injections are typically administered intramuscularly (IM), meaning the medication is injected into a muscle, often in the thigh or buttocks
